Dinah Shore (born Frances Rose Shore) was an American singer, actress, and television personality. She was most popular during the Big Band era of the 1940s and 1950s.

After failing singing auditions for the bands of Benny Goodman and both Jimmy Dorsey and his brother Tommy Dorsey, Shore struck out on her own to become the first singer of her era to achieve huge solo success. She enjoyed a long string of over 80 charted popular hits, lasting from 1940 into the late '50s, and after appearing in a handful of films went on to a four-decade career in American television, starring in her own music and variety shows in the '50s and '60s and hosting two talk shows in the '70s. TV Guide magazine ranked her at #16 on their list of the top fifty television stars of all time. Stylistically, Dinah Shore was often compared to two popular singers who followed her in the mid-to-late '40s and early '50s, Doris Day and Patti Page.

Someone’s In The Kitchen with Dinah – and that’s just what this is like – she’s right there on the pages chatting away and telling you how she makes the recipes or how the “someone” whose recipe it is makes it for her. Dinah Shore is still one of my favorites and I ‘m glad I have two of her cookbooks at hand to pull out from time to time.
